Discover how Jaguar Land Rover develops their next-generation engines to deliver high-fidelity modeling of GDI engines.
 
Future EU7 emission standards come into effect in 2025 and require improved fuel efficiency and reduced CO2 emissions of IC engines, with an increasing trend to adopt various technologies such as direct fuel injection & boosting.
 
The major challenges faced by OEMs when developing a GDI engine include particulates, hydrocarbons, and wall film. To capture and model liquid film formation is pivotal to predicting and simulating high-fidelity GDI CFD simulations. Accurate models improve the predictive power to capture combustion stability, efficiency and emission formation, which are all key to meeting emissions standards.
 
During the development of the Ingenium Engine family, Jaguar Land Rover (JLR) extensively used CAE with STAR-CD as the preferred combustion simulation tool. As JLR develop its next-generation engines, they collaborated with Siemens DISW to deploy the Simcenter STAR-CCM+ In-cylinder Solution to deliver high fidelity modeling of GDI engines, addressing these major challenges.
